Cyclone Fengal Live Updates: Tamil Nadu Weather Forecast

Cyclone Fengal has started making landfall near Puducherry. This process is expected to take about four hours. As of 5:30 PM, the cyclone was located 60 km east-northeast of Puducherry, moving at 7 km/h. The forward sector of its spiral bands has reached land. Heavy rain is affecting parts of Tamil Nadu and Puducherry. Flight operations at Chennai airport are suspended until 4 AM on Sunday.

Education and Work Impact

The Tamil Nadu government has declared a holiday for all educational institutions across the state. IT companies are advised to allow employees to work from home. Public transportation services are suspended on the East Coast Road and Old Mahabalipuram Road.

Emergency Preparedness

The Chief Minister of Tamil Nadu, MK Stalin, reviewed the cyclone preparedness today. A total of 471 people from 164 families have been moved to six relief centers in Tiruvallur and Nagapattinam districts. For emergencies, boats, generators, and essential equipment are ready. The National Disaster Response Force and state rescue teams are deployed in vulnerable areas.
